Empirical research in the field of law has long recognized the salience of the “law on the books” (constitutions, statutes, judicial decisions), but it has also looked at how the law is implemented and experienced by those affected by it. Studies of legality or legal consciousness, behavioral law and economics research, scholarship on compliance theory, and studies of law agency organization are examples of this type of work.

The main goal of this type of research is to identify a set of law-related phenomena that deserve closer examination and possibly scholarly study. Then, a methodology can be devised for gathering and analyzing data relevant to those phenomena in order to test, develop or refine hypotheses. This type of research can be applied to all areas of the law, including civil rights, criminal justice, property, torts, public policy and family law.

A number of resources can be used to assist with finding law review articles. The most popular are Westlaw and LexisNexis, but a number of other legal periodicals indexes can be used as well, such as LegalTrac and HeinOnline. Westlaw and LexisNexis require passwords, but HeinOnline is freely available to all Loyola students with a valid ID.
